Engine running rough and clanking.. :(
my 81 240D has been running fine up til this morning... when it started running a bit rough and now there is a little bit of clanking going on in the engine area.. its no too bad- i've read on the forum people talking about 'nailing' where it sounds like metal hammer hitting metal., its not that bad, just sort of a diesely clanking sound- i have a 77 240D that hasnt got much love from me yet, and it clanks a bit when it goes, so now my 81 sounds a bit like that. i also have a ford psd 7.3, same thing, has that school bus diesel clank thing happening..
BUT, unlike my PSD or the 77, the 81 is running rough with the clanking, so it seems to be more of an issue. its kind of an uneven chugging during idle rather than a smooth purr. almost like it might die, but it doesnt. it still gets up to speed on the highway, just feels a little rougher and a louder chugging & clanking noise when running. i realize this is probably very vague,, and could be lots of things, but any suggestions on where to start? i for 1 want to make sure continuing to drive it isnt going to be harmful, and 2 how to get her back to a smooth purr. i havnt done anything to it recently that would have changed things, or affected how it runs. i recently changed fuel filers, and topped off the engine oil. i havnt done a valve adjustment before, but have been meaning to learn how to do one, im not sure when the last time the PO had one done. from what ive read around here, people seem to suggest injectors, IP, vacuum pump... ???
